Refer to this Accessible Event Checklist when planning any event to make sure you are following our accessibility guidelines! Additionally, please review the best practices outlined below the checklist for more detailed information regarding planning accessible events.
Accessible Event Checklist
- [ ] advertise events at least 2 weeks in advance so that folks have enough time to request accommodations
- [ ] include the approved accessibility statement in any advertising/reminder emails
- [ ] [for in-person events] ensure the event venue has accessible entrances and bathrooms
- [ ] [for events with food] ask attendees to email you about any food allergies/dietary restrictions ahead of time
- [ ] ask speaker for permission to make slides available before or after the presentation
- [ ] ask speaker for permission to record the presentation for those who cannot attend
- [ ] whenever possible, include a Zoom/virtual option for events
- [ ] [for online or hybrid events] enable closed captions on Zoom
- [ ] share presentation materials (slides and/or recording) after the event
